Every Tennis Tipping player is allowed to do managing. New managers usually start with challenger tournaments but there is no rule on it. If you want to manage a tournament, make sure that you have enough time every day to do the updates and post the differences. You just have to ask for a free tournament in the TT Managers thread and the thread owner (Marto) will confirm your managing by adding your name on the front page - or in case of any absence one of the other Board Members.
Please make sure you update your front pages when your event ends - these are used by Gavin and Sergio for their rankings.
